1. China Tourist Visa
A visa required for most foreign nationals. Allows a stay of up to 30 days. Can be extended at local Public Security Bureau.
- Application Process: Online application available, but must submit physical documents at embassy or consulate.
- Required Documents: Passport, completed application form, passport-sized photos, proof of accommodation in China, and evidence of sufficient funds.
- Processing Time: Typically 4-10 business days. Expedited services available for an additional fee.
